CND.WS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2022 in Review
1 of the 6,237 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Concord Acquisition Corp. Warrants, each whole warrant exercisable for one share of Class A Common Stock at an exercise price of $11.50 (CND.WS) for Q4 2022, worth a combined $580K — down 98% from $24.5M a quarter earlier.
Sellers outnumbered buyers: 16 funds closed out of CND.WS and 0 opened new positions — a net loss of 16 holders — while 0 trimmed existing stakes and 0 added.
The largest seller was Anson Funds Management, exiting entirely with an estimated $12.6M sold.
